MSP-RSW o/w FCM was hovering around $416. As is the return. $832 for domestic 739 F. Too expensive as a fare. Waaaay to expensive as an FCM.
Yesterday the outbound dropped to $170. I have a cold and a backache, and have to make this trip for meetings, so I took it. I don't imagine the return will drop in price, but I have a decent C+ seat on a 752, so I don't care very much. Considering MSP-DEN offers have been about $106 o/w for me for a while (no meal, just a snack basket for the 90 min MD90 hop), the suddenly reduced RSW deal was Okay. Overall, though, I've gone from accepting 4 or 5 FCMs in 2016 when they were moderately priced to I think zero last year. I had a nice rollover on top of Plat without any mileage boosts, too. |
